Dinitrile compound containing ethylene oxide moiety with enhanced solubility of lithium salts as electrolyte solvent for high-voltage lithium-ion batteries

英文摘要a dinitrile compound containing ethylene oxide moiety (4,7-dioxa-1,10-decanedinitrile, neon) is synthesized as an electrolyte solvent for high-voltage lithium-ion batteries. the introduction of ethylene oxide moiety into the conventional aprotic aliphatic dinitrile compounds improves the solubility of lithium hexafluorophosphate (lipf6) used commercially in the lithium-ion battery industry. the electrochemical performances of the neon-based electrolyte (0.8 m lipf6 + 0.2 m lithium oxalyldifluoroborate in neon:ec:dec, v:v:v = 1:1:1) are evaluated in graphite/li, licoo2/li, and licoo2/graphite cells. half-cell tests show that the electrolyte exhibits significantly improved compatibility with graphite by the addition of vinylene carbonate and lithium oxalyldifluoroborate and excellent cycling stability with a capacity retention of 97 % after 50 cycles at a cutoff voltage of 4.4 v in licoo2/li cell. a comparative experiment in licoo2/graphite full cells shows that the electrolyte (neon:ec:dec, v:v:v = 1:1:1) exhibits improved cycling stability at 4.4 v compared with the electrolyte without neon (ec:dec, v:v = 1:1), demonstrating that neon has a great potential as an electrolyte solvent for the high-voltage application in lithium-ion batteries.
